Subject : Computer Science Class: 11
Period: First Unit: 5
Topic: Programming Concepts & Logic Time: 45 min
Teaching Item: Compiler Interpreter & Assembler, Software & program and programming statements Number of Students : 50

SPECIFIC OBJECTIVES[edit | edit source]

At the completion of this topic students will be able:

  • Understand about compiler Interpreter & Assembler

TEACHING MATERIALS[edit | edit source]

  • Daily materials
  • White Board
  • Marker
  • PowerPoint Slides

TEACHING LEARNING ACTIVITIES[edit | edit source]

  • Greeting to the students and topic will be written on board
  • Previous Topic will be revised in short
  • By showing the slides in the PowerPoint, compiler Interpreter & Assembler will be explained.
  • After that Program and software be explained
  • After programming statements will be explained
  • At last Lesson will be concluded.

EVALUATION[edit | edit source]

  • What is Compiler?
  • Define Software and program

HOME WORK[edit | edit source]

  • Difference between Compiler and interpreter.
  • What is programming statements?
